Highlights
Are people in Lowell older or younger than people in Crayne?
- The Median Age in Lowell is 7.4 years older than in Crayne.
Are housing costs cheaper in Lowell or Crayne?
- Lowell
housing
costs are 42.1% more expensive than Crayne hous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Lowell or Crayne?
- The average commute for residents of Lowell is 12.2 minutes longer than it is for residents of Crayne.
